16B, BRINSONS CLOSE, BURTON, CHRISTCHURCH, BH23 7HS - £232,500

16B BRINSONS CLOSE is a very small extended semi-detached house of 73m², built sometime between 1996 and 2002. It was last sold for £232,500 in August 2012, which was around 29% below the average August 2012 detached price in the Bournemouth Christchurch and Poole local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was October 2021, where the current energy rating was D, and the potential energy rating was B.

16B BRINSONS CLOSE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average detached house price in the Bournemouth Christchurch and Poole local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The four 16B BRINSONS CLOSE sales between March 1996 and August 2012 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the December 2006 sale was for 27% below the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 27% below the HPI over time, until the August 2012 sale, where it falls to 29% below the HPI. The line then continues to track at 29% below the HPI.
